Stories
Slash Boxes
Comments

News for nerds, stuff that matters

Slashdot Log In

Log In

Create Account  |  Retrieve Password

iPhone App Enables GSM To WiFi/VoIP Switching

Posted by timothy on Mon Jun 30, 2008 03:50 AM
from the voices-in-the-ether dept.
alias420 writes "You can save on long distance and air time with the new 3G iPhone. iPhone Hacks has the scoop on an upcoming iPhone 2.0 App named 'iCall', that will let you switch between VoIP and normal GSM calls anywhere in North America. You can check out their recently released video proof of call switching in action . This software requires no hacks and will be completely official. Here is a little quote from the developer: 'We are part of the Apple iPhone developer program. This is not an application for you naughty jail breakers ;-)'"
+ -
story

Related Stories

This discussion has been archived. No new comments can be posted.
The Fine Print: The following comments are owned by whoever posted them. We are not responsible for them in any way.
 Full
 Abbreviated
 Hidden
More
Loading... please wait.
  • I am confused... (Score:5, Insightful)

    by ulash (1266140) on Monday June 30 2008, @04:05AM (#23997537)

    ... couldn't you do this anywhere in the world with a phone running Skype for Mobile [skype.com] or practically any VoIP provider of your choice using a PocketPC? Either that summary is way too summarized or there really isn't anything exciting here other than saying this is now possible on an iPhone too...

    • Re: (Score:3, Insightful)

      or there really isn't anything exciting here other than saying this is now possible on an iPhone too...

      That's what's "exciting" about it. Every feature or rumour about the Iphone gets its own story, whilst every other phone manufacturer is ignored. Of course I predict that there will be replies saying that this feature is somehow different on the Iphone, because it "Just Works" or something.

      See, next we'll have an article about the next Iphone supporting 3G...

  • by bpkiwi (1190575) on Monday June 30 2008, @04:13AM (#23997577)
    From what they showed, they are not actually switching the call, they are establishing a parallel voip call, then dropping the cellular call. This is unlikely to work seamlessly the other way around, since if you are on voip and walk out of wireless range it will take some time before a cellular call can be dialled to replace it.
  • iPhone VoIP SDK (Score:4, Informative)

    by chrb (1083577) on Monday June 30 2008, @04:16AM (#23997591)

    There's an official VoIP SDK for the iPhone [phonesreview.co.uk], so expect similar apps to follow from other providers. The only limitation is that you can't VoIP over the GPRS/Edge/3G data connection.

  • american woes (Score:3, Informative)

    by kubaZA (676589) on Monday June 30 2008, @04:22AM (#23997623)
    i suppose this is actually only "really" useful for americans. in other gsm coutries (at least in europe) we don't pay for recieving incoming phones calls. of course, making outgoing calls over wifi is pretty useful (especially considering the rates we pay for making calls outside of our own countries).
  • by Jason Pollock (45537) on Monday June 30 2008, @04:27AM (#23997653) Homepage

    This would need you to take a new phone number, much like Grand Central.

    Then, when the call arrives, the SIP Invite is forwarded to the application (if running), and the user is prompted to decide on delivery mechanism.

    If the app isn't running, the call is connected. If at a later point, the user starts the application, the app registers with the service, and, if desired, the call is dropped from the mobile connection and sent to the VoIP link using a reinvite (probably).

    This can be probably be done using Asterisk on the server side. The nifty bit is the VoIP client on the iPhone. Other than that, the service looks pretty bulk standard.

    This definitely wouldn't need anything other than the standard APIs.

    What they aren't doing is using the built-in Mobile Phone Application and intelligently re-routing outgoing calls based on the presence of a WiFi connection, the way that TruPhone was going last September.

    I think they would have some pretty extreme problems constructing a business case around selling this through the AppStore. Apple's current billing and charging limitations pretty much kill it instantly.

  • by StarKruzr (74642) on Monday June 30 2008, @05:41AM (#23997977) Journal

    What exactly is "naughty" about using hardware you paid for in the way you want?

    Value judgements on behavior that harms no one. Delightful.

    I'm sure someone who has some amount of respect for freedom will come up with an app that delivers similar functionality soon.

  • n95 SIP over ATT 3G (Score:4, Informative)

    by Anonymous Coward on Monday June 30 2008, @05:57AM (#23998027)

    i guess this is only news because its for the iphone, while other phones have done this for a long time. i have been able to use my n95 SIP client to make free calls over the 3G connection for a long time now. ATT doesnt seem to block that data traffic here in the states. unfortunately truphone promo finally ended so calling cell and landlines is no longer free. but for the last year i could do 100% of my calling totally free, as data, and not use 1 cell minute from my plan. rack up those roll over minutes:)

  • Should be built in (Score:3, Informative)

    by mosb1000 (710161) <mosb1000@mac.com> on Monday June 30 2008, @06:06AM (#23998043) Homepage

    If anyone has used ATT in southern california, you've probably noticed that it needs all the help it can get. It would be wonderful if I could use my wireless internet to make calls out of my apartment. As it is now, I have to run outside whenever my phone rings. More bars in more places my ass!

  • by L4t3r4lu5 (1216702) on Monday June 30 2008, @06:15AM (#23998067)
    Your carrier may make VoIP over data connections against the ToS. I know O2 in the UK do.

    As it is, I have an E51 and use WiFi for VoIP calling. I may drop the tarrif altogether and get a PAYG sim just to keep the phone active, and for when out of WiFi range.

    If I can't use the data connection I pay for without limitations, they don't get my money. Simple as.
  • Nokia N95 and Gizmo (Score:3, Informative)

    by kurt555gs (309278) <kurt555gs1@ a i m.com> on Monday June 30 2008, @09:00AM (#23998967) Homepage

    I have an N95, and Gizmo. If I want to make a call that would be expensive on the cell side, I just find a WiFi hot spot and use the Gizmo Voip program.

    It works great, especially while traveling in areas where the the AT&T roaming charges would stagger a billionaire.

    Not news, just iPhone news.

    • so in theory you could us an all data plan and use skype for your outgoing calls.

      Provided you have a flat-rate data plan with a price tag small enough to actually make your scenario work. Which will not be all that common for the iPhone 2. Telcos are not stupid. They will identify the exact amount of data transfer which is precisely enough for "regular" customers to never actually reach it, but no where near enough to use the device for streaming, VoIP, or similar services/technologies.

      A normal smartphone users spends around 100 megs a month. Including constant syncs with his company exchange server. An advanced smartphone user spends about the double of that. The iPhone 2 will be launched with a 300 meg data plan. Not flat-rate. Coincidence? I think not.

      300 megs is more than enough for just about every "normal" smartphone user. But not enough to throw in VoIP, radio-streaming on the road, or mobile pr0n.

      - Jesper

      • 300 megs is more than enough for just about every "normal" smartphone user. But not enough to throw in VoIP, radio-streaming on the road, or mobile pr0n.

        That's what they think. Ascii pr0n FTW!

    • Re:Carefull now ... (Score:5, Informative)

      by chrb (1083577) on Monday June 30 2008, @04:18AM (#23997597)

      VoIP calling is only over Wifi, so the data tariff limitations are irrelevant - the SDK simply doesn't allow call switching over non-Wifi data connections.

      • Re: (Score:3, Interesting)

        the SDK simply doesn't allow call switching over non-Wifi data connections.

        Interesting. I didn't know that.

        But if all new iPhones were sold with true flat-rate data, your can be sure that someone would create an app for hacked iPhones doing exactly that: call switching over 3G/HSDPA connections... ;-)

        For the telcos, the only way to fight the problem is to ensure that the dataflow is too expensive - making normal calls a more attractive choice.

        - Jesper

        • Re:Carefull now ... (Score:5, Informative)

          by fdobbie (226067) on Monday June 30 2008, @06:26AM (#23998101) Homepage

          Actually, first hand experience of making calls over 3G (HSDPA) packet data connections using Fring on Three [three.co.uk] shows that call quality is terrible. Admittedly this was in central London, where cells may be quite heavily contended, but once people actually start using 3G you can quite regularly see bursts of latency - causing the throughput to go through the floor.

          You get a guaranteed QoS with a proper voice call. You do not with packet data. In fact, Three's own "Skype" service is based on iSkoot, which does uses packet data for getting the contact list, setting up a call etc - but it actually carries calls over a proper voice channel.

          • by yabos (719499) on Monday June 30 2008, @07:21AM (#23998323)
            When I was at WWDC I didn't want to pay the $2.70 per minute(roaming) to call home so I tried fring with my skype account. It worked but the latency was terrible and the quality was only OK, not good. I was using the free public wifi at the conference and there were probably 2000 iPhones or more there so who knows, it could have been interference or something. I did however, try it at home and the call quality was still pretty bad. Latency was still kind of high as well but I was behind NAT in both situations.
          • Actually, first hand experience of making calls over 3G (HSDPA) packet data connections using Fring on Three [three.co.uk] shows that call quality is terrible

            Wow. Given how atrocious GSM (and CDMA) phone quality is relative to good old POTS (or even analog cell technology), 3G VoiP must be really unconscionably awful.

            I am frankly stunned at how many people are switching to mobiles as their only phone. When I'm talking to someone who's on a mobile phone - particularly if I'm on one as well - I am constantl

            • Re: (Score:3, Insightful)

              As someone who has a mobile as my only phone, I just don't use the phone that often. It's not important that I have crystal clarity as long as I can get what business done that I need to, and have a nice chat with my parents.

              I've found that it really depends more on your device than the call itself. I can hear everyone perfectly well, and they understand me, as long as no one's using an el-cheapo phone.

        • Re: (Score:3, Informative)

          If they were sold with flat-rate data, there would be pretty much no reason to require call switching. At least in the US, the few areas that have 3G coverage have reliable signal. If you've got the bandwidth and you've got the reliability, why add in an additional point of potential failure?

          I suppose something that would automatically re-route incoming cellular calls over the VOIP/data connection would be of use, but at that point you should just be giving out your VOIP number and avoid that whole proble

    • Re:Carefull now ... (Score:5, Informative)

      by nmg196 (184961) * on Monday June 30 2008, @06:49AM (#23998187)

      I don't see why any of what you said is relevant as this software only works on WiFi and NOT on 3G connections??
      Have you actually read the article?

      From TFA:
      "It promises seamless call switching between VoIP via WiFi and regular calls. "
      and
      "Apple has explicitly stated that VoIP is allowed, just not over Edge networks"

      I'm not sure therefore, why you've been modded as insightful when your post is totally wrong - unless I'm missing something??

    • Re:VoIP (Score:5, Informative)

      by antifoidulus (807088) on Monday June 30 2008, @04:31AM (#23997671) Homepage Journal
      They have. I'm a yank living in Germany and I get Telekom's "country select" plan to call home for about 3.5 cents/minute. However, you can tell that the connection isn't over the wire, its voip.....however they are still charging me more than skype.
    • Re: (Score:3, Informative)

      The reason it's disabled over EDGE is because EDGE is very high latency and low data rate. It would be terrible to try VOIP over it. Actually I remember when the iPhone voip app called fring first came out, the people at tuaw tried a call over EDGE and it was complete garbage.
      • Re: (Score:3, Informative)

        UMA a short-term hack? Hardly. Until EVERYONE uses VoIP, UMA will be needed. Also, unless the transition from GSM->VOIP/VOIP->GSM is seemless, it's a hack. UMA is seemless. Also, so what if the carrier needs to cooperate? Decent carries (i.e. T-Mobile) already cooperate.